Post-Holiday Return Surge Persists at Bus Terminals

Despite the end of the school holiday, a steady stream of travelers continues to pour into East Jakarta’s Kampung Rambutan Bus Terminal.

The number of arrivals could exceed 1,000 by 11 PM

According to Revi Zulkarnain, Manager of Kampung Rambutan Terminal, 381 passengers on 44 long-haul buses have arrived as of this morning.

'We anticipate the number of arrivals could exceed 1,000 by 11 PM," he noted, Monday (1/5).

He explained that arriving passengers are predominantly from West and Central Java, including cities such as Cirebon, Subang, Indramayu, Kuningan, Tegal, Brebes, and Pemalang, as well as parts of Sumatra

"We have seen daily fluctuations during the year-end holidays, but arrivals tallied a high of 1,510 passengers this past Sunday," he explained.

He added, security and health posts are scheduled to stay active until Monday night, with the Ciracas Police transitioning to mobile patrols thereafter.

"We continue to remind passengers to stay within the terminal area when arriving, as a safety precaution during the late-night and predawn rushes," he added.

Among those returning to the capital was Sarya, 35, who arrived Monday following an extended break in Subang, West Java.

"Alhamdulillah (thank God), the trip home and the journey back here were very smooth," he stated.
